Reasons y i still feel it cud be a dream:

1. almost every scene is a repeat of what inshi have already done before. the almost kiss was done in macau, the 'to kijiye na' was same as 'pvt mein aa jaun', n many more!
2. indu cud not imagine the kiss & the SR pieces bcoz she has no experience there. she completed those pieces theoretically & moved on after rishi says...the next part is not for kids (which is again a repeat of a similar dialogue 'aap to bacchi nahi hai na' by rishi in the episode where she dresses his wounds) knowing rishi, his version wouldnt have been so censored😛
3. she did not smile even once in the entire dream. if rishi was imagining her, the first thing he wud have imagined is her smile...or rather indira laughing like crazy @ something he said. her smile is dat important to him! remember he u used to carry her 'ek din main bhi hasungi' chit wid him wherever he went like a charm! this unsmiling indira even after so many happy events take place in her life cannot be rishis dream!
4. the whole thing is how rishi will be as a husband. he changes his name, he takes care of the kids, he plays wid the kids, he objects to their marriage. if rishi had been dreaming wudnt it have been the other way round...like indu being happy, indu gradually trusting him & opening up wid him, joking wid him. these r things which matter to rishi. the dream was full of responsibilities which usually matter more to indira.
5. the saree sequence...i know dis bit is too technical...n in HD thr r bloopers galore, but does indu really own such a fancy saree with such a fancy blouse 😆looking at her wardrobe (other than her marriage ka lehenga which was just wow!!!!) the saree does look like a dream😛 n knowing wat rishi is (remember the fotos he has changed on the matrimony site) i doubt he wants to see her in a saree...saree is too sweet n innocent like indu...rishi is neither 😈
6. yesterday nobody acknowledged rishi during the saree thing. it was as if only indu cud see him. strange if he was thr...like some sort of a ghost 😆
7. as soon as rishi leaves to meet the pandit mandy = responsibility, enters. she is taunted, she gets unreasonable, n hence indu starts feeling guilty.
8. since friday all things seem like individual scenes. there is no connect bween them. plus rishi planning his marriage on the very day he put his family behind the bars is just 🤢 i dont expect him to be sorry but this scene a day or two later would have been better
9. to immediately think of marriage after any bad patch in life ends is usually something indu does. she thinks marrying rishi will offer her some solace. for her its simple...if rishi has to be in her life its as her husband (her love confession...she says she wants to be mrs. rishi kumar, after being rescued from jail she again asks him to marry her)

all things said...i can only add one thing. if its a dream rishis character is saved. if its real indiras character is saved. but in the end, InShi lose! more on this part after the actual episode/s😛

NOTE: my entire post depends on the rishi kumar/ ricky diwan we have been shown till thursdays episode! now if the CVs decide to ruin his character in a single day like they did wid sam, inder, etc...all this is gonna go for a toss
